Bob - Automobile History
I purchased my fist car as a Junior in High School - a new 1970 Ford "Maverick" with two options - Carpet (instead of rubber mats) and Wheel Covers (instead of hub caps). 

That car got me through High School, College, and into my first job at Tampa Electric.  After 7 years and 98,000 miles, I sold it for half of what I had purchased it for new.
My second car was a 1976 Datsun 280Z which I also purchased new.  That car lasted 24 YEARS and 180,000 miles.

It was "totalled" in an accident in August 2000.
My third car was a 1997 Mazda Miata, which I'm still driving.  It was purchased after coming off a 3-year lease with less than 24,000 original miles.  It is a FUN car.  Debbie and I enjoy putting the top down and driving around with an "oldies" radio station playing.
